Hi, how are you? A couple of days ago, my PC (with Windows 10) won't start up. When I turned off the PC, the day before the problems started, it had to update, so I just press the "update and turn off" option. The error code that gives me is the 0xc000021a. Every time loads the repair mode but can't fix it by itself. From the repair mode also, I try to execute the sfc /scannow mode, but says to me "Windows resources protection can't perform the requested operation" (or something like that, my Windows is in spanish and I have to translate it xD). Also, I've tried to restore the system to an old restoration point, and can't too. Neither I can enter the safe mode, although I press repeatedly the F5 or F8. When I've tried to fix the problems from my USB flash drive that contains the W10 installation files, from the repair mode, in the command line, execute scannow and tells me that there's a pending operation and needs to be restart, although I've restarted it a lot of times. Also, I've tried to revert the changes of a bad updates, with same poor results. I boot into Hiren's Boot's Mini Windows XP, ran chkdsk to the hard drive, fix some little errors but it is ok. Also checked with Hard Disk Sentinel Pro, which showed that the HDD was in a perfect status. Any ideas to fix the boot sector and keep my install just how it was? I don't want to format my drive, but I know that's the easier solution.
My specs are:
Athlon X2 250
MSI 990-GA55
8GB RAM DDR3 1866
Nvidia GT 430
WD 500GB (the W10 drive)
Samsung 1TB
